A Greater Manchester takeaway has been named 'best in the north' at the Food Awards England 2023. The awards celebrate the best of the country’s food industry, shining a spotlight on the best restaurants, takeaways, pubs, cafes, and producers.
The awards ceremony was held on Monday, October 9 at The Birmingham Conference & Events Centre. It recognises and rewards the talent and hard work of the English food industry, whilst also promoting the industry and championing its diversity and quality.
The winners were selected based on public votes, with their favourite establishments across various categories, including Restaurant of the Year, Gastro Pub of the Year, Fine Dining Restaurant of the Year and Best Street Food amongst others nominated.

While Birmingham restaurants and takeaways picked up an impressive number of awards, two Greater Manchester businesses also picked up gongs. Zafrani Indian Takeaway in the village of Monton in Eccles took home the award for Takeaway of the Year North, beating tough competition from across the region.
It's not the first time the takeaway has been recognised for its great cooking though, as in 2016 it picked up the same award, while in 2018 it was named the Best Takeaway of the Year in England. The team at Zafrani are passionate about curry, and their menu is combined with fresh, British ingredients with a western twist.
